When it comes to pursuing a career in Information Technology, specializing in a specific area can be a great way to stand out in the competitive job market. Many diploma programs offer the opportunity to focus on a particular area of IT, allowing you to develop expertise in that field. Let's explore how you can specialize in a specific area within Level 5, Level 6, and Level 7 Diploma programs.
The Level 5 Diploma in Information Technology provides a solid foundation in various IT concepts and skills. While this program covers a broad range of topics, you can still start to specialize in a specific area by choosing elective courses that align with your interests. Some common specializations at this level include:
Specialization | Description |
---|---|
Network Administration | Focuses on designing, implementing, and managing computer networks. |
Software Development | Emphasizes programming languages and software design principles. |
Database Management | Covers database design, implementation, and maintenance. |
As you progress to the Level 6 Diploma, you can delve deeper into your chosen specialization. This level typically offers more advanced courses that allow you to hone your skills in a specific area of IT. Some popular specializations at this level include:
Specialization | Description |
---|---|
Cybersecurity | Focuses on protecting computer systems and networks from cyber threats. |
Cloud Computing | Explores the use of cloud services for storage, processing, and networking. |
Web Development | Emphasizes creating dynamic and interactive websites and web applications. |
Finally, the Level 7 Diploma allows you to become an expert in your chosen specialization. At this level, you can undertake a research project or thesis that delves deep into a specific area of IT. Some advanced specializations at this level include:
Specialization | Description |
---|---|
Artificial Intelligence | Explores the development of intelligent machines and systems. |
Big Data Analytics | Focuses on analyzing and interpreting large and complex data sets. |
Information Systems Management | Covers the strategic use of IT to achieve organizational goals. |
